Sofia Kenin started her Wimbledon campaign strongly, defeating Taylor Townsend in two sets. She aims to reach the third round for the second consecutive year.
Kenin's first serve accuracy was at 75%, and she converted 4 out of 10 break points in her first match.
Dayana Yastremska (ranked No. 42) is favored against Jessica Bouzas Maneiro (ranked No. 62) in their upcoming match. The odds are -210 for Yastremska and +160 for Bouzas Maneiro.
Bouzas Maneiro has a 2-1 record on grass courts this year, with an 80.6% winning percentage in service games and 28.1% in return games.
Yastremska has a 6-2 record on grass this year, winning 70.9% of her service games and 37.5% of her return games. She has a 62.2% break-point conversion rate on grass.
